Chamber Celebrates Jalisco Mexican Grill 10-Year Anniversary
The Greene County Chamber of Commerce proudly hosted a ribbon-cutting ceremony celebrating the 10-year anniversary of Jalisco Mexican Grill, a beloved local restaurant located next to Parkside Main Theater and Metropolis Café. The name “Jalisco” (pronounced Ha-Lis-Co) honors the Mexican state where owner Raquel (Kelly) Torres was born and raised. Inspired by her roots and a lifelong dream, Torres opened the restaurant to bring authentic Mexican cuisine to the Greensboro community.
Jalisco Mexican Grill is truly a family affair. Torres is joined by her daughter, Paulina Macias, and son, Javier Macias, both of whom were raised in Greensboro. Together, they have built not only a successful business but also a strong connection to the local community. Over the years, the family has remained committed to giving back. Torres shared that the restaurant regularly supports local schools by providing meals for students and teachers, as well as contributing to other community organizations. Paulina Macias emphasized the family’s dedication, saying they want the community to know that both their family and Jalisco Mexican Grill are proud to call Greensboro home—and they are here to stay. The Greene County Chamber congratulates Jalisco Mexican Grill on this milestone and looks forward to many more years of success.
